What Are Bitcoin Transaction Fees?

Bitcoin transaction fees are small amounts of BTC paid by users to miners for processing and confirming transactions on the blockchain. These fees serve as an incentive for miners to include your transaction in the next available block. Without fees, miners would have little motivation to prioritize one transaction over another, potentially leading to network congestion and delays.

Every time you send Bitcoin from one wallet to another, your transaction is broadcast to the network. Miners then select which transactions to include in a block based on the fee per unit of data (measured in satoshis per byte). Higher fees mean faster confirmation times.

Network Congestion

Bitcoin’s blockchain can only process a limited number of transactions per block (approximately every 10 minutes). When demand exceeds supply—such as during periods of high market activity—users compete by offering higher fees to get their transactions confirmed quickly.

During bull runs or major market events, fees can spike dramatically. For instance, at peak times in previous cycles, fees have exceeded $50 per transaction. In contrast, during low-usage periods, fees can drop below $1.

Tools like mempool visualizers allow users to monitor pending transactions and current fee rates in real time, helping them choose optimal pricing.

Why Do Fees Matter for the Bitcoin Network?

Transaction fees play a crucial role in maintaining the security and sustainability of the Bitcoin network. As block rewards halve every four years (a process known as "the halving"), miners increasingly rely on fees to remain profitable.

After the 2024 halving, the block reward dropped from 6.25 to 3.125 BTC. By 2140, when all 21 million Bitcoins will be mined, block rewards will cease entirely. At that point, transaction fees will become the sole incentive for miners to secure the network.

Thus, a healthy fee market ensures long-term decentralization and resistance to attacks.

Can I send Bitcoin without paying a fee?

Technically, yes—but your transaction may never be confirmed. Miners prioritize transactions with higher fees, so zero-fee transfers are often ignored.

Why did my Bitcoin fee seem so high compared to the amount I sent?

Small transactions with multiple inputs can result in disproportionately high fees due to increased data size. Always consider fee-to-value ratio when sending small amounts.

Do all wallets charge the same fee?

No. Wallets differ in how they estimate fees and optimize transaction structures. Some support SegWit addresses, which reduce data size and lower fees by up to 40%.

Will Bitcoin fees ever go down permanently?

While short-term drops occur during low-demand periods, long-term trends suggest fees will gradually rise as adoption grows and block space remains limited. However, Layer-2 solutions like the Lightning Network offer near-zero fee alternatives for small payments.

Tips for Reducing Bitcoin Transaction Fees

  1. Use SegWit Addresses: These modern address formats (starting with bc1) reduce transaction size and lower fees.
  2. Avoid Peak Times: Schedule large transfers during weekends or off-peak hours when traffic is lower.
  3. Batch Transactions: If you're managing multiple payouts (e.g., payroll), combine them into a single transaction.
  4. Set Custom Fees: Use advanced wallet features to fine-tune your fee based on current mempool conditions.
  5. Leverage Child-Pays-For-Parent (CPFP): If your transaction is stuck, some wallets allow you to speed it up by sending a follow-up transaction with a higher fee.
  6. Explore Lightning Network: For small, frequent payments, this off-chain solution offers instant settlements with negligible fees.

The Future of Bitcoin Fees

As Bitcoin evolves, so do solutions for managing transaction costs. The adoption of Taproot and Schnorr signatures has already improved efficiency and privacy. Meanwhile, Layer-2 protocols like Lightning continue gaining traction, enabling microtransactions without burdening the main chain.

Institutional adoption and regulatory clarity may also stabilize fee markets over time. However, scarcity of block space will likely persist, reinforcing the importance of smart fee management.
